NRC-IRAP Overview • Industrial Research Assistance Program is under the umbrella of the National Research Council • NRC-IRAP’s roots are 60+ years strong in 2008 • Technical specialists and not just transfer payment specialists • Today NRC-IRAP provides targeted advice and assistance to some 7,600 SMEs annually

  3. … Combining a national and regional presence …The ITA advantage • ~240+ Industry Technology Advisors (ITAs); 147 locations across Canada. • Experienced individuals with research and/or industry experience - 2nd or 3rd careers • Huge collective knowledge pool- Linked to the expertise of all staff through the national network • ITAs on average make about 100 client on-site visits per year

Client Profile • Canadian companies with < 500 employees. 82% of NRC-IRAP clients have fewer than 50 employees – and most of them have fewer than 20. • Covers broad range of industry sectors Common challenges faced include limited: • R&D capacity and staffing. • Availability of private investment for R&D. • National and international networks to assist with competitive intelligence and commercialization.

  5. What does NRC-IRAP do? • Technological and Advisory Service to SMEs • Financial Support to Bring New Skills into Firms • Financial Support to Firms for Research and/or Development • Financial Support for Organizations Providing Innovation Assistance to SMEs • Networking and Linkages

Technological and Advisory Services & Networking/Linkages • Constitutes the majority of IRAP client assistance and includes: • Linkages to NRC and other research based organizations. • Technical literature and product searches. • Patent searches for IRAP clients. • Canadian Association of Management Consultant & Rotman School of management consultation. • Networking to utilize ITA technical capacity.

Financial Support for New Skills – Youth Employment Program • Max. contribution of $15K per youth • Covers salary costs of college/university graduate • Grad must be under 31 • Project based on 6 –12 months employment • Must benefit both firm and youth • Must add new technical or business capabilities to firm to support innovation

Financial Support for R&D • Research, Development, Adaptation/Adoption Funding (Non-repayable) • New Product or Process Development • Market Research Studies • Technology Inflow from Outside Canada • Firm must be incorporated, with <500 employees • Project must increase innovation capacity of firm • IRAP contributes towards salaries & subcontractor costs • Does not cover capital, equipment
